Mirrormind
About
Mirrormind is a 3D Puzzle Platformer in a unique lo-fi dithered style where you can shift perspective into any person you can see. Journey through a series of worlds where each world explores a shift in perspective. These shifts include an exploration of gravity, the 2nd person perspective, and more.
Explore 4 visually striking worlds about switching perspectives: using different directions of gravity, controlling yourself in the 2nd person perspective and switching between past and present.
Over 50 different puzzles, each focused on showing some unique and interesting consequence of its mechanics.
Unique undo system where you can reverse time to quickly explore other solutions.
A parallel and optional narrative exploring themes of perspective, senses, sights and experience.
Acquire Challenge Collectables which unlock Appendix levels, unique levels experimental levels that highlight other decision decisions.
Mirrormind treats your time as precious; there is no filler in this game and the levels have been crafted to minimise tedium and frustration. There are no puzzles that require a high degree of dexterity.
